Natalie's Score: 87/100

Dry, crisp and clean with a medium weight and no heavy oak. Good aperitif.

Pinot Grigio food pairings: grilled salmon steaks, herb-rubbed roast chicken.

This Filadonna Tedeschi Pinot Grigio 2011 was reviewed on October 27, 2012 by Natalie MacLean

Reviews and Ratings

A delightfully aromatic Pinot Grigio featuring aromas of peach, apricot, apple, cinnamon and a hint of honey. Dry, softly textured, with ripe peach, apple and spices replayed. It finishes with some fresh acidity to give it a lively, remarkably long finish. Made by a Veneto power-house, this is Italian Pinot Grigio at its pinnacle. Source: Vintages Wine Catalogue.
